Output 3172905f3a68d6bdeb0ddd200d55fc601bb2638a95f018766ecf94fcd5af9857:1

value
3010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b46a71e9e9e82caceeb6ce65a0db37c9f6e2e8 OP_EQUAL
address
3JM52y1WJ4kWSBqpWQx8bQTWEmxThKuYHq
transaction
3172905f3a68d6bdeb0ddd200d55fc601bb2638a95f018766ecf94fcd5af9857
spent
true